    Quote Originally Posted by Donjo View Post
    So, what's the problem with Tanks? It's that Vitality, their main stat, is treated the same way for them as it is for everyone else: once you can survive the fight, stop worrying about it. It is the only main stat that becomes less useful at certain thresholds.
    Very interesting point.
    It could be interesting to find an another effect that VIT could offer to counter this.

    I think the problem is twofold :
    - Vitality only gives HP
    - Healing spells are too strong

    Why is "more HP" a problem ? Because, unless you're at max HP, you actually don't care what your max HP is. If you have only 1000 HP left, one 1000 hit will kill you, wether you have 2000 or 25000 max HP
    As for healing spells, the problem is that healers don't care about auto-attacks. They can keep you alive from auto-attacks for...well, forever, in fact. If their wasn't any tankbusters, tanks would be invincible.

    So, what can be changed :
    1) Vitality should add a constant mitigation. That way, if you have 1000 HP left, a 1000 hit (before mitigation) will not have the same effect depending on your vitality.
    2) Healing spell's potencies should adjusted so that auto-attacks are a real thing, not a minor annoyance. That way, adding vitality would still be useful since its much more difficult to mitigate auto-attacks in the long run.

    After that, it can be interesting to decide if Vitality would only be physical mitigation, and Mind for magical mitigation (And Dark Mind could be a swap between the two like Cleric Stance).
    Or vitality could enhance heals received, to the same effect, having a constant effect on your mitigation/recovery.

    As a sidenote, Piety is the same...enough MP to manage the fight, then the rest is useless...but nobody actually focuses on Piety, so, who cares
